Boy Name · Sanskrit Origin
Tarangaksh
तरंगाक्ष
Quick Answer
Tarangaksh (तरंगाक्ष) is a Sanskrit-origin boy's name meaning "wave-eyed." It is associated with Swati nakshatra and Tula rashi. The Chaldean numerology value is 9 (Compassion).
Meaning & Etymology
Meaning
wave-eyed · one whose eyes are like waves · gaze that undulates like water
Etymology
From Sanskrit "taranga" (wave, ripple, undulation — of water or wind) + "aksha" (eye, gaze); he whose gaze moves like waves — fluid, mesmerizing, and always in motion.

Why This Name Fits Swati Nakshatra
In Vedic astrology, the nakshatra (lunar mansion) at the time of birth determines which syllables are auspicious for the child's name. Swatinakshatra prescribes names starting with "Ru", "Re", "Ro", "Ta".Tarangaksh begins with "Ta", making it a traditionally appropriate choice for children born under Swati.
The belief is that using the correct starting syllable aligns the child's name with the vibrational energy of their birth nakshatra, creating harmony between the individual and the cosmos. This practice is recorded in the Brihat Parashara Hora Shastra and is still widely followed across India.
